How they compare

Belgium currently reports 2,474 against 2,324 in Bulgaria, a difference of 150.

That makes Belgium's figure about 1.1 times Bulgaria's.

The two have swapped places 20 times across 46 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Belgium ahead.

Belgium ranks 18th and Bulgaria ranks 20th of 27 countries.

Across the 5 decades both report, Belgium averaged higher in 4 and Bulgaria in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Belgium Bulgaria Difference Ahead
1980s 3,033 2,911 121.6 Belgium
1990s 2,818 2,831 12.89 Bulgaria
2000s 2,648 2,625 22.92 Belgium
2010s 2,698 2,513 185.37 Belgium
2020s 2,469 2,317 151.97 Belgium

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
